   38 #include <sys/cdefs.h>
   39 __FBSDID("$FreeBSD: releng/6.1/sys/kern/tty_conf.c 158179 2006-04-30 16:44:43Z cvs2svn $");
   40 
   41 #include "opt_compat.h"
   42 
   43 #include <sys/param.h>
   44 #include <sys/systm.h>
   45 #include <sys/tty.h>
   46 #include <sys/conf.h>
   47 
   48 #ifndef MAXLDISC
   49 #define MAXLDISC 9
   50 #endif
   51 
   52 static l_open_t         l_noopen;
   53 static l_close_t        l_noclose;
   54 static l_rint_t         l_norint;
   55 static l_start_t        l_nostart;
   56 
   57 /*
   58  * XXX it probably doesn't matter what the entries other than the l_open
   59  * entry are here.  The l_nullioctl and ttymodem entries still look fishy.
   60  * Reconsider the removal of nullmodem anyway.  It was too much like
   61  * ttymodem, but a completely null version might be useful.
   62  */
   63 
   64 static struct linesw nodisc = {
   65         .l_open =       l_noopen,
   66         .l_close =      l_noclose,
   67         .l_read =       l_noread,
   68         .l_write =      l_nowrite, 
   69         .l_ioctl =      l_nullioctl, 
   70         .l_rint =       l_norint, 
   71         .l_start =      l_nostart, 
   72         .l_modem =      ttymodem
   73 };
   74 
   75 static struct linesw termios_disc = {
   76         .l_open =       tty_open,
   77         .l_close =      ttylclose,
   78         .l_read =       ttread,
   79         .l_write =      ttwrite, 
   80         .l_ioctl =      l_nullioctl, 
   81         .l_rint =       ttyinput, 
   82         .l_start =      ttstart, 
   83         .l_modem =      ttymodem
   84 };
   85 
   86 #ifdef COMPAT_43
   87 #  define ntty_disc             termios_disc
   88 #else
   89 #  define ntty_disc             nodisc
   90 #endif
   91 
   92 struct linesw *linesw[MAXLDISC] = {
   93         &termios_disc,          /* 0 - termios */
   94         &nodisc,                /* 1 - defunct */
   95         &ntty_disc,             /* 2 - NTTYDISC */
   96         &nodisc,                /* 3 - loadable */
   97         &nodisc,                /* 4 - SLIPDISC */
   98         &nodisc,                /* 5 - PPPDISC */
   99         &nodisc,                /* 6 - NETGRAPHDISC */
  100         &nodisc,                /* 7 - loadable */
  101         &nodisc,                /* 8 - loadable */
  102 };
  103 
  104 int     nlinesw = sizeof (linesw) / sizeof (linesw[0]);
  105 
  106 #define LOADABLE_LDISC 7
  107 
  108 /*
  109  * ldisc_register: Register a line discipline.
  110  *
  111  * discipline: Index for discipline to load, or LDISC_LOAD for us to choose.
  112  * linesw_p:   Pointer to linesw_p.
  113  *
  114  * Returns: Index used or -1 on failure.
  115  */
  116 
  117 int
  118 ldisc_register(int discipline, struct linesw *linesw_p)
  119 {
  120         int slot = -1;
  121 
  122         if (discipline == LDISC_LOAD) {
  123                 int i;
  124                 for (i = LOADABLE_LDISC; i < MAXLDISC; i++)
  125                         if (linesw[i] == &nodisc) {
  126                                 slot = i;
  127                                 break;
  128                         }
  129         } else if (discipline >= 0 && discipline < MAXLDISC) {
  130                 slot = discipline;
  131         }
  132 
  133         if (slot != -1 && linesw_p)
  134                 linesw[slot] = linesw_p;
  135 
  136         return slot;
  137 }
  138 
  139 /*
  140  * ldisc_deregister: Deregister a line discipline obtained with
  141  * ldisc_register.
  142  *
  143  * discipline: Index for discipline to unload.
  144  */
  145 
  146 void
  147 ldisc_deregister(int discipline)
  148 {
  149 
  150         if (discipline < MAXLDISC)
  151                 linesw[discipline] = &nodisc;
  152 }
  153 
  154 /*
  155  * "no" and "null" versions of line discipline functions
  156  */
  157 
  158 static int
  159 l_noopen(struct cdev *dev, struct tty *tp)
  160 {
  161 
  162         return (ENODEV);
  163 }
  164 
  165 static int
  166 l_noclose(struct tty *tp, int flag)
  167 {
  168 
  169         return (ENODEV);
  170 }
  171 
  172 int
  173 l_noread(struct tty *tp, struct uio *uio, int flag)
  174 {
  175 
  176         return (ENODEV);
  177 }
  178 
  179 int
  180 l_nowrite(struct tty *tp, struct uio *uio, int flag)
  181 {
  182 
  183         return (ENODEV);
  184 }
  185 
  186 static int
  187 l_norint(int c, struct tty *tp)
  188 {
  189 
  190         return (ENODEV);
  191 }
  192 
  193 static int
  194 l_nostart(struct tty *tp)
  195 {
  196 
  197         return (ENODEV);
  198 }
  199 
  200 int
  201 l_nullioctl(struct tty *tp, u_long cmd, char *data, int flags, struct thread *td)
  202 {
  203 
  204         return (ENOIOCTL);
  205 }
